  • SimpleDateFormat accomodates for daylight savings?

    Does SimpleDateFormat print out the date/time of a particular timezone in its daylight savings time? or always in its standard time?
    SimpleDateFormat formatter = new SimpleDateFormat("dd/MM/yyyy HH:mm");
    formatter.setTimeZone(TimeZone.getTimeZone("Australia/Sydney"));
    System.out.println(formatter.format(new Date()));I'd like to know that by the time we're in November when daylight savings starts, the code will actually print me the correct daylight savings time, not the standard time.
    Thank you in advance.

    Well, you can just try it out, can't you? Try this:
    Calendar cal = Calendar.getInstance();
    cal.set(Calendar.YEAR, 2005);
    cal.set(Calendar.MONTH, Calendar.NOVEMBER);
    cal.set(Calendar.DAY_OF_MONTH, 12);
    SimpleDateFormat formatter = new SimpleDateFormat("dd/MM/yyyy HH:mm");
    formatter.setTimeZone(TimeZone.getTimeZone("Australia/Sydney"));
    System.out.println(formatter.format(cal.getTime()));
    cal.set(Calendar.MONTH, Calendar.JUNE);
    System.out.println(formatter.format(cal.getTime()));On my system (Windows XP, Java 1.4.2_08) it prints out:
    12/11/2005 21:51
    12/06/2005 19:51So yes, it automatically takes daylight savings into account.
